Combine Krka National Park's cascading freshwater waterfalls with a guided exploration of UNESCO-listed Trogir's medieval old town on this full-day private tour from Šibenik. You'll swim in emerald pools, walk through Dalmatian villages, and discover centuries of Venetian architecture without the crowds of larger group tours.

Perfectly balanced half-day tour for an active but not too exhausting day that offers something natural and something man-built. Krka waterfalls are very beautiful and are not far from Split. After that we will visit UNESCO protected city Trogir and experience it's pure Mediterranean spirit. There are several options for meals, either some local restaurant or local family farms or wineries.

Insider tips

  • Book dining in advance if choosing a family-run winery or farm; guides can arrange authentic local experiences unavailable to walk-in visitors
  • Bring waterproof bags and quick-dry clothing—swimming in the pools is the highlight, and multiple photo-worthy cascades reward early arrival before day-trippers
  • Ask your guide about lesser-known viewing platforms above the main falls for quieter perspectives and better lighting for photos

Good to know

  • Swimming costume, towel, and water shoes or sandals recommended; waterfalls are slippery
  • 8-hour duration includes travel time, swimming breaks, and Trogir walking; plan accordingly for ship schedules if cruise-based
  • Private tour accommodates mobility levels—confirm walking intensity preferences when booking
  • Krka National Park entrance fee may apply (verify with supplier); typically included or noted separately

Best time to visit

Visit May–September for warm water and reliable sunshine, ideally mid-morning before afternoon crowds arrive at the falls. Winter offers solitude but cold water and shorter daylight.
